The Indian Judiciary Exam serves as the gateway for law graduates aiming to begin their careers in the judiciary. It offers an opportunity to work in the lower courts, which is the initial step towards serving the public and ensuring justice in the legal system.
In India, the judiciary exam is conducted to recruit members for the lower courts. This recruitment process is managed by the state government and supervised by the high court of the respective states.
Candidates selected for the Indian Judiciary enjoy various benefits, including rent-free accommodation, travel allowances, subsidized utilities, and telephone allowances, among others. These perks add to the appeal of a career in the esteemed Indian Judiciary.

Selection Process for Upcoming Judiciary Exams The selection procedure for the upcoming judiciary exams typically encompasses three phases:
Preliminary Examination: This phase involves multiple-choice questions (MCQs) and acts as a preliminary screening. Marks obtained in the preliminary exam do not contribute to the final merit list.
Main Examination: The main exam is a subjective assessment comprising multiple papers. Marks from the main exam factor into the final merit list.
Viva Voce: The final phase is the viva voce, where candidates are evaluated based on their personality, general knowledge, and other factors. The viva voce holds certain weightage in the final selection process. It's worth noting that exam patterns and selection processes may vary slightly across states.
